摘要
以鬼笔复膜孢酵母菌和红托竹荪为研究对象,进行腐烂病病原菌侵染试验、不同药物的抑菌试验、药物对红托竹荪菌丝的影响试验、高温和pH对病原菌的影响试验。结果显示,鬼笔复膜孢酵母菌对红托竹荪菌丝、菌棒均具有致病性,且致病性随温度的升高而增强;鬼笔复膜孢酵母菌生长适宜的pH为4~8,pH大于10不生长;鬼笔复膜孢酵母病原菌在55℃条件下2 h失活;丙环唑对鬼笔复膜孢酵母菌有强抑制作用,但对红托竹荪菌丝同样具有抑制作用且持效期长。研究结果可为红托竹荪腐烂病的综合防治提供方法。
Taking Saccharomycopsis phalli and Dictyophora rubrovolvata as reseach subjects,for the infection test of the pathogen of rot disease,the bacteriostasis test of different drugs,the influence test of drugs on the mycelia of D.rubrovolvata,the influence test of high temperature and pH on the pathogen.The results showed that the yeast of S.phalli had pathogenicity to the hyphae and fungus rods of D.rubrovolvata,and the pathogenicity increased with the increase of temperature.The suitable pH for the growth of S.phalli is 4 to 8,and no growth occurs when the pH is greater than 10.The pathogenic bacteria of S.phalli were inactivated at 55℃for 2 hours.Propiconazole has a strong inhibitory effect on Saccharomycopsis phalli,but it also has a long lasting effect on the mycelia of D.rubrovolvata.The results can provide a method for the integrated control of D.rubrovolvata rot.
